Inside the Role

This position is responsible for leading a group of commercial vehicle suppliers, in providing quality powertrain components. The position is within the Supplier Management and Purchasing department and will report to the responsible Supplier Management Quality Supervisor.

What

You Drive at DTNA
  • Work with the supplier to ensure supplier performance is regularly reported and that appropriate and timely corrective actions are implementedli>
  • Manage timely resolution of supplier technical issues to ensure uninterrupted supply to production.
  • Strategically lead supplier performance improvement projects in an effort to increase the supplier capability of consistently meeting customer existing or new requirements.
  • Document activities related to investigation, disposition, and resolution of quality complaints.
  • Conduct supplier audits to confirm product conformity, or drive process standardization, waste elimination, and continuous improvement.
  • Monitor, communicate and improve key supplier quality KPIs, including DPPM, Quality Complaints, and capacity to support OTS (On Time Ship) compliance.
  • Lead or support effort to establish specific short / long-term supplier quality goals.
  • Champion problem solving and root cause analysis activities with suppliers and customers to eliminate recurrence of non-conformances.
  • Work to resolve supplier technical issues in a timely manner to ensure continuity of supply.
  • Interface and support cross‑functional business units on topics relating to supplier quality.
  • Oversee containment actions at the supplier to mitigate the impact of quality issues to Daimler.
  • Domestic and international travel (expected 30-50%).
Knowledge You Should Bring
  • Bachelor's degree in engineering with 1 year of related experience OR 5 years of related experience required.
  • Demonstrates strong verbal and written communication skills.
  • Ability to present complex technical topics during meetings with suppliers and Daimler management.
  • Knowledge of GD&T and MSA.
  • Ability to understand metallurgical requirements and interpret reports.
  • Strong problem solving skills and a solution‑focused mindset.
  • Understanding of quality problem solving tools such as 8D, 5‑why, fishbone, etc.
  • A customer‑focused mindset with the ability to understand and address customer needs and expectations related to supplier quality topics.
Exceptional Candidates Might Have
  • Project management experience
  • Statistical process control experience
  • Familiarity with Engine, Axle, and Transmission components
  • Experience with various manufacturing processes such as machining, casting, injection molding, stamping, & forging.
  • Experience working with global suppliers and managing quality across different regions and cultures.
  • Knowledge of a foreign language
